How Do You Find The Best Web Hosting?

Friday, December 25th, 2009

If you choose less than the best web hosting service your potential for loss becomes compounded. Websites for business, non-profits, volunteer organizations, and even fun need to have reliable and efficient web hosting services in order to reliable websites for the user. Otherwise you simply end up losing potential visitors to your site.

When you get your website up and running you want to provide a high quality experience for the user. You want them to be able to find, download material, upload material, and cruise the site without any major interference by slow load times or down time due to poor servers. If your user find that more often than not your site is not accessible, they will move on to sites that are more reliable. It only takes one down experience to lose potential users. All of these experiences are directly tied to the web hosting service that you choose. Your budget needs are obviously one of the more important concerns, but choosing a poor host based on price alone will cost you much more in the long run.

You can find that just about every advertised service promises you the best web hosting service possible. With strong pitches and a lot of potential promises for fast upgrades and customized service, many web owners neglect to take the time to check out their actual reliability
record. In the end, this costs them much more than the fraction of time it would have taken them to find out the host’s reliability.

Your website’s reputation is based primarily on its ability to remain accessible and secure. When your host does not deliver on its promises you can’t expect your users to sit idly by while you deal with the host. The average user is not really interested in understanding why your site is down once again.

Security is an essential part of effective web hosting. Without proper security neither you nor your users are really safe. If you are taking payments on your unsecure site the fallout will not be blamed on the host, but on you and your site. Make sure that the web hosting service you choose has a very strong reputation for secure service.

When you are choosing your host you have to give consideration to how much space you will need. The more you intend on adding graphics or video to your site the more you will need a larger percentage of bandwidth. If you continuously update your website you will want the ability to upgrade your storage space. Just like a parking space, bad things happen when the space is just way too small for the space you need to store your information. Being able to access the latest technology and web improvements through the server is a huge benefit.

There are a lot of web hosting services that offer Linux program bases. If you are in need of a Windows based server, the Linux program base isn’t going to help you much. Each platform needs a corresponding web host. Without it you are once again trying to park the wrong vehicle into the wrong storage space.

When you’re looking for the best web hosting services remember that there will be times when sending an email to support just will not do. You will need to be able to get in contact with a real person. Make sure the support team is reachable via land line or cell phone so that you can always reach someone to help you through those moments where your website is threatening to crash.
